Synergistic Activities and Recognitions

 
   
  • Invited by Swedish Academy of Sciences in 2002 to nominate a suitable scientist from India for consideration for the award of Nobel Prize in Chemistry.
  • Appointed as a Technical Advisor on Environment and Ecology to Inter-State and Water Resources Wing to defend the case of Andhra Pradesh before New Krishna Water Tribunal (G.O. Rt. No. 15).
  • Appointed as a Committee Member of the Core Group and an Expert Panel to guide the Inter-state Wing in conducting the cases related to the new Tribunal constituted to adjudicate the disputes in Krishna Basin.
  • Appointed as a Member of the A.P. Sate water, land and trees authority.
  • Acted as a Member in the Board of Governors of the Environment Protection Training and Research Institute (EPTRI), Hyderabad from 2000 – 2002.
  • Acted as a member of UGC and CSIR expert panel in various committees.
  • Acting as Chairman, Board of Studies in Environment, Pharmacy and Biotechnology of JNTU.
  • Member of Academic Senate, JNT University –2004
